Does anyone have any experience on the Jeanneau Cap Camarat 8.5 CC?

Will be used as a day boat in the med.

Just looking for general opinions, anything to look for when viewing them, known faults etc?

Thanks in advance
 
We are looking at twin 225 yamahas, although i am not looking advice on the engine brands themselves....

Advice on if this is too much power etc would be appreciated though :)
 
I've driven a few of these in the med around this size, not the 8.5 but the old 755WA and the 925WA and I have to say I prefer the ones with a big single Yam 350 V8s, the twins are sluggish by comparison and handling is nowhere near as fun. I don't really see the need for a twin if you are coast hugging in the med.
 
The twin engines are more down to market availabilty rather than my preference...

One would be ideal, less maintenance etc...
